Translating Technology Risk Into Business Decisions
Technology Risk Management Fundamentals by Edward Henriquez is a comprehensive educational guide designed to bridge the gap between technical conditions and business outcomes . The text outlines a structured curriculum that moves from foundational risk concepts and governance to specialized areas like cybersecurity , cloud computing , and artificial intelligence . Henriquez emphasizes a practical workflow where practitioners learn to identify, assess, and treat risks while maintaining clear accountability and evidence-based reporting . By focusing on business service mapping and control effectiveness , the book teaches readers how to translate technical vulnerabilities into informed executive decisions . The ultimate objective is to provide a repeatable framework that ensures technology risks are visible, understood, and aligned with an organization’s risk appetite .
